    Hi, I have been trying for awhile as well to book reservations for Blue Bayou for September 26 for 6 guest and there’s no confirmation.. try again.. it seems ever time i have done this in the past visit to the park for this restaurant I get same response..

    Hiya, Elia. Thanks for stopping by planDisney with your question about dining reservations.

    Blue Bayou is one of the most atmospheric and memorable dining locations at the Disneyland Resort. I have had the good fortune to dine there on a couple of occasions with some of my planDisney friends.

    Here is what you need to know: Advanced Dining Reservations open between 2 and 60 days before a given date. Reservations can be made in the Disneyland Mobile App or on the Disneyland Resort website. Please note that reservations for Blue Bayou book incredibly quickly - often on the same day they open, two months in advance. I recommend being online right at the 60-day mark.

    Elia, with your visit coming up next week, there may be no reservations available for the day you'd like. However, I recommend checking back up until the day of your visit, as more may open as other Guests' plans change. You might also try joining the Walk-Up List by visiting the restaurant directly on the day of your visit. I recommend arriving right as the restaurant opens and being flexible with your dining time for the best chance at scoring a same-day seating. You can also check the Walk-Up Lit in the Disneyland Mobile App, though you will need to be near the restaurant for this option to be available in the app. I hope this helps!
